Oppenheimer & Co. Inc. reduced its stake in shares of Icahn Enterprises L.P. (NASDAQ:IEP – Free Report) by 9.4% during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 18,452 shares of the conglomerate’s stock after selling 1,919 shares during the period. Oppenheimer & Co. Inc.’s holdings in Icahn Enterprises were worth $167,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.
Several other hedge funds have also recently bought and sold shares of IEP. Meridian Wealth Management LLC raised its holdings in Icahn Enterprises by 5.1% during the 4th quarter. Meridian Wealth Management LLC now owns 21,171 shares of the conglomerate’s stock worth $184,000 after buying an additional 1,026 shares during the period. Raymond James Financial Inc. acquired a new stake in Icahn Enterprises during the 4th quarter worth approximately $969,000. Moors & Cabot Inc. raised its holdings in shares of Icahn Enterprises by 8.1% in the fourth quarter. Moors & Cabot Inc. now owns 48,355 shares of the conglomerate’s stock valued at $419,000 after purchasing an additional 3,642 shares during the last quarter. Axxcess Wealth Management LLC acquired a new stake in shares of Icahn Enterprises in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$447,000. Finally, Virtu Financial LLC acquired a new stake in shares of Icahn Enterprises in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$856,000. 87.09% of the stock is currently owned by institutional investors and hedge funds.
Icahn Enterprises Price Performance
NASDAQ IEP opened at $8.51 on Friday. The company has a quick ratio of 3.04, a current ratio of 3.04 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.82. Icahn Enterprises L.P. has a 12-month low of $7.27 and a 12-month high of $17.93. The company has a market capitalization of $4.65 billion, a PE ratio of -5.16 and a beta of 0.77. The firm’s 50 day moving average is $8.58 and its 200-day moving average is $9.06.
Icahn Enterprises Announces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, June 25th. Stockholders of record on Monday, May 19th were issued a $0.50 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, May 19th. This represents a $2.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 23.49%. Icahn Enterprises’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ently -121.21%.

Icahn Enterprises Company Profile
Icahn Enterprises L.P., through its subsidiaries, engages in the investment, energy, automotive, food packaging, real estate, home fashion, and pharma businesses in the United States and Internationally. The Investment segment invests its proprietary capital through various private investment funds. This segment provides investment advisory and other related services.
